Job Summary
Preeminent is seeking a Human Resources Specialist to join our team and manage our Onboarding and HR process. The Specialist will be responsible for communicating the company and position details to new hires before their start date and ensuring that employees submit all new hire paperwork prior to their start date. You will be responsible for assigning new hire training and ensuring that employees complete training before their start date. The specialist will also assist in other areas of to include recruiting and other administrative tasks.
Responsibilities
- Craft and send emails with information about the company and position.
- Schedule Onboarding & New Hire’s Orientation dates.
- Ensure that new hires submit their new hire documents.
- Communicate with the Recruiting dept, for successful transition of employee from recruiting to onboarding.
- Communicate with the Operations dept. to ensure that employees have a successful transition from onboarding to their start date.
Qualifications
- Proven work experience as an HR Onboarding Specialist or in relevant HR role
- Hands-on experience with Human Resources Information Systems (HRIS)
- Basic knowledge of labor legislation
- Solid communication skills (verbal and written)
